Medulloblastoma Comprises Four Distinct Molecular Variants

TL;DR: The authors' integrative genomics approach to a large cohort of medulloblastomas has identified four disparate subgroups with distinct demographics, clinical presentation, transcriptional profiles, genetic abnormalities, and clinical outcome.

Medulloblastoma Growth Inhibition by Hedgehog Pathway Blockade

TL;DR: This compound caused regression of murine tumor allografts in vivo and induced rapid death of cells from freshly resected human medulloblastomas, but not from other brain tumors, thus establishing a specific role for Hh pathway activity in medullOBlastoma growth.

Subgroup-specific structural variation across 1,000 medulloblastoma genomes

TL;DR: Somatic copy number aberrations (SCNAs) in 1,087 unique medulloblastomas are reported, including recurrent events targeting TGF-β signalling in Group 3, and NF-κB signalling in Groups 4, which suggest future avenues for rational, targeted therapy.
